Certification and accuracy

Singapore certified translation for visit visa applications

Certification should identify the translated material and make the responsible translator or provider traceable. Where a certified translation is requested, the translation may need an accuracy statement, date, translator identity, signature and contact information. The exact elements must follow the destination guidance. Singapore submissions often use English but may involve Chinese or Malay content. Academic, professional and corporate records require accurate terminology and well-controlled formatting. Avoid preventable problems

Common translation issues

Submitting unexplained partial statements; translating an invitation but not supporting civil records; inconsistent employment details; using machine translation for official evidence. A Singapore file can also be weakened by choosing a language without written confirmation, omitting reverse pages, mixing passport spellings, or treating translation, legalization and attestation as one process.

Does certified translation include apostille or embassy attestation?

No. Certification, notarization, apostille, legalization and attestation are separate unless the quotation expressly includes a particular step.
